Re: Thaumaturgist & Wizard???
Yeah, as mentioned, Planar Ally is only a couple of spell lists (Cleric, Apostle of Peace), and only a couple of domains (Summoner, Dragon Below).
The Hathran PrC will also do it, as will the Nightbringer Initiate feat (this will be tough for a Wizard to access, though). Both are pretty campaign specific. Hathran is also broken-good, so the DM may be wary of it.

Re: Thaumaturgist & Wizard???
Master Specialist
Expanded Spellbook: When you reach 2nd level, you can add one spell of your chosen school to your spellbook. The spell can be of any level that you can cast, and it is in addition to the normal spells gained when increasing your level.
Spoiler: this works as long as you ignore the errata
https://web.archive.org/web/20090602...age_Errata.zip
Page 70 – Expanded Spellbook
[Revision]
First sentence should read, “When you
reach 2nd level, you can add one
wizard spell of your chosen school to
your spellbook.”
